This is a fully remote position, open to applicants in Illinois.
• Build and sustain relationships with large provider groups that have a membership of 1,000 or more.
• Evaluate provider performance metrics and clinical operations to assess readiness for value-based care and risk management.
• Identify areas for improvement and create data-driven strategies to enhance provider performance and financial incentives.
• Work collaboratively with cross-functional teams to evaluate practice operations in relation to primary care best practices.
• Develop and deliver training programs, workshops, and educational resources for both providers and staff.
• Lead discussions on clinic operations, quality benchmarks, regulatory compliance, member experience, and patient-centered care.
• Spearhead initiatives for provider performance improvement and execute performance enhancement plans.
• Track progress and assess the effectiveness of interventions in partnership with practice teams.
• Conduct audits, reviews, and evaluations of provider practices, documentation, and compliance standards.
• Collaborate with clinical and operational leadership, value-based care teams, quality management, and provider relations departments.
• Utilize data management systems and analytical tools to gather, analyze, and present provider performance data.
• Create reports, dashboards, and presentations for senior leadership stakeholders.
• Keep abreast of industry trends, best practices, and changes in regulations.
• Support initiatives related to population health and health equity while conducting research and benchmarking activities.
